From an international perspective, Agbayani’s presence in Playboy was marketed through an "exoticized" lens, a common trope for Asian women in Western media at the time. However, Agbayani leveraged this platform to transition from a local actress to an international figure, eventually appearing in Hollywood productions like The Emerald Forest . This trajectory highlights the magazine's role as both a problematic purveyor of stereotypes and a powerful, if controversial, tool for global visibility. The Lasting Legacy
Back home, the reaction was polarized. While some critics labeled the move "immoral," many Filipinos praised her for her bravery and for representing Filipina beauty globally.
